Consider the following statements:
i. Citizenship is the concern of municipal law.
ii. Nationality is the concern of international law only.
iii. There is no provision for nationality in the Constitution of India.
Choose the correct answer:

A

i, ii and iii are correct

B

i and ii are correct

C

ii and iii are correct

D

i and iii are correct

Answer

i and iii are correct

Explanation

Solution

Citizenship is primarily regulated by municipal (domestic) law, while nationality is governed by international law. The Constitution of India does not directly mention nationality, as it focuses on citizenship.
